Construction of Weyl Matrix for Schrödinger Operators on Carbon Nano‐Structures

Dong‐Jie Wu, Chuan‐Fu Yang, Natalia P. Bondarenko, Rafael Abeldinov

ABSTRACT

In this paper, we develop a method for synthesis of the Weyl matrix for Schrödinger operators on carbon nano‐structures which are equivalent to the hexagonal lattice. We construct Weyl matrices for graphs that contain any number of hexagons by adding new edges and solving elementary systems of linear algebraic equations at each step. Our method can be applied in numerical simulations for studying inverse spectral problems for differential operators on hexagonal lattices.
